3. Who was the French Dictator suddenly in control of Louisiana?​
a_sh-v [17]

Answer:

Emperor Napoleon Bonaparte

In 1801 after a series of secret agreements, French Emperor Napoleon Bonaparte (1769–1821) recovered the territory of Louisiana from Spain, which France had lost in 1763.
